Huevos Rancheros is a vibrant and hearty Mexican breakfast dish that brings together crispy corn tortillas, savory black beans, and perfectly fried eggs topped with zesty salsa. This simple yet satisfying meal is perfect for any time of day, whether you’re looking for a quick breakfast or a leisurely brunch.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 15 oz can black beans (rinsed and drained)
  • 1 ¼ cups salsa (store-bought or homemade)
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 4 corn tortillas
  • 1 tbsp butter (or olive oil)
  • 4 large eggs
  • Salt and pepper
  • 1 large avocado (sliced)
  • Crumbled Cotija cheese (optional)
  • Fresh cilantro (optional)

Instructions

  1. In a small skillet, combine the black beans and ½ cup of salsa. Heat over medium until simmering, then reduce to low and cook for about 5 minutes, partially mashing the beans.
  2. In another skillet, heat olive oil over medium-high. Fry the tortillas for about 30-90 seconds on each side until crispy, keeping them warm between paper towels.
  3. In a nonstick skillet, melt butter or oil over medium heat to fry the eggs to your liking—aim for runny yolks.
  4. Assemble by placing a tortilla on each plate, topping it with the bean mixture, a fried egg, remaining salsa, sliced avocado, and optional garnishes.
